Flowers Galore
Been away from house for about a month and when I got back Spring was showing its face.
I love these white bell shaped flowers They are from a Texas twisted leaf yucca. They grow all around the house but the deer love to eat the flower stems because they are so tender and tasty that the only place it blooms is in the backyard within the fenced in area
Just next to those are a solid patch of wild flowers. If I would have been home I would have mowed that area. Nature has a way of surprising you with its beauty.
Just on the other side of the fence some bushes have produced red berries I sit on the back porch and watch the birds pick them off while trying to dodge the other birds doing the same thing The berries are just getting ripe so I bet the birds will have it stripped within the next few days.
